The Importance of Sleep for the Elderly

As people age, sleep becomes an essential component of maintaining overall health and wellbeing. Unfortunately, many elderly individuals face challenges that affect their ability to enjoy a restful night’s sleep. These challenges can include chronic pain, medical conditions, and the natural changes in sleep patterns that accompany aging. According to the National Institute on Aging, older adults need about 7 to 9 hours of sleep each night, but many struggle to achieve this due to various factors.

Lack of quality sleep can lead to a host of health issues, including weakened immune function, cognitive decline, and increased risk of chronic diseases such as hypertension and diabetes. Moreover, poor sleep quality can significantly impact mood, leading to feelings of irritability or depression. Therefore, finding solutions that enhance sleep for the elderly is crucial for promoting their overall health and quality of life.

How Adjustable Beds Enhance Comfort and Support

Adjustable beds are designed to offer a personalized sleep experience by allowing users to adjust the position of the mattress to suit their specific needs. This feature is particularly beneficial for seniors who may suffer from conditions such as arthritis, back pain, or acid reflux. By elevating the head or feet, adjustable beds can help reduce pressure on painful areas, improve circulation, and minimize symptoms of certain health conditions.

One of the most significant advantages of adjustable beds is their ability to improve spinal alignment. When the body is properly aligned, it can reduce strain on the muscles and joints, leading to a more comfortable and restful sleep. Additionally, adjustable beds can help alleviate symptoms of sleep apnea and snoring by elevating the head, which opens up the airways and facilitates easier breathing.

Furthermore, adjustable beds are equipped with features such as massage functions and zero-gravity settings, which can enhance relaxation and support. The zero-gravity position, for example, mimics the posture astronauts take during liftoff, distributing weight evenly and relieving pressure on the body. These features make adjustable beds a well-regarded choice for seniors seeking to improve their sleep quality and overall comfort.

Health Benefits of Adjustable Beds for Seniors

The health benefits of adjustable beds extend beyond mere comfort and support. For seniors, these beds can play a crucial role in managing and alleviating symptoms of various health conditions. For instance, by elevating the legs, adjustable beds can help reduce swelling in the lower extremities, a common issue among older adults due to poor circulation or conditions such as edema.

Additionally, adjustable beds can aid in digestion by allowing users to sleep in an inclined position. This can be particularly beneficial for seniors experiencing acid reflux or GERD, as it helps prevent stomach acid from traveling back up the esophagus. The ability to customize the bed’s position can also promote better breathing, which is vital for individuals with respiratory issues or sleep apnea.

Moreover, the enhanced comfort and support provided by adjustable beds can lead to improved mental health. Quality sleep is closely linked to mood regulation and cognitive function, both of which are critical for maintaining mental wellbeing in older adults. By ensuring a restful night’s sleep, adjustable beds can contribute to a more positive outlook and better cognitive performance.

Choosing the Right Adjustable Bed for Seniors

Selecting the right adjustable bed involves considering various factors to ensure it meets the specific needs of the senior user. First and foremost, it’s essential to assess the bed’s adjustability features. Look for beds that offer a wide range of positions and settings, allowing for maximum customization and comfort.

Another important consideration is the mattress type. Adjustable beds are compatible with various mattress types, including memory foam, latex, and hybrid models. Each type offers different levels of support and comfort, so it’s crucial to choose one that aligns with the user’s preferences and health requirements.

Additional features such as remote controls, USB ports, and under-bed lighting can enhance the user experience, making the bed more convenient and user-friendly. It’s also wise to consider the bed’s durability and warranty, ensuring it provides long-lasting support and peace of mind.
